The Versatility and Benefits of Glass Window Doors
Glass window doors have progressively become a popular option for homeowners and commercial properties alike. Their allure lies in their sophistication and performance, as they allow natural light to fill areas while supplying a seamless connection between indoor and outdoor environments. This short article explores the specifics of glass window doors, exploring their types, benefits, installation considerations, and maintenance pointers, while addressing frequently asked concerns that prospective purchasers might have.

Natural Light: Glass window doors maximize natural light, causing brighter, more inviting spaces.

Visual Appeal: With their streamlined design, glass doors can elevate the exterior and interiors of a property.

Energy Efficiency: Modern glass doors typically feature low-E glass that assists to keep homes warmer in the winter season and cooler in the summer, minimizing energy expenses.

Enhanced Connection with Nature: They provide unobstructed views of the outdoors, enhancing the total atmosphere and making homes feel more roomy.

Adaptability: Available in numerous styles and finishes, glass doors can complement any architectural design.

Increased Property Value: Homes with well-installed glass doors usually have greater residential or commercial property values due to their appeal and functionality.
Installation Considerations
When considering the installation of glass window doors, there are a number of factors to consider:

Professional Installation: Engaging experienced specialists ensures that the doors are installed correctly, maintaining security and performance.

Frame Materials: The selection of frame products (wood, aluminum, uPVC) can impact resilience, maintenance, and visual appeals.

Kind of Glass: Considerations for thickness, security features, and insulation properties are essential for long-lasting efficiency.

Building Codes and Regulations: Ensure that the installation adheres to local building regulations and requirements, especially concerning security and energy performance.

Budget: Analyze expense ramifications, including products, setup, and prospective upkeep.
Upkeep Tips
Proper care can prolong the lifespan and maintain the visual appeal of glass window doors. Here are some maintenance ideas:

Regular Cleaning: Use a mixture of moderate soap and water to clean both the glass and framing. Prevent abrasive cleaners that might scratch the surface area.

Inspect Seals and Weather Stripping: Regularly check the seals and weather stripping for indications of wear. This is important for preventing drafts and enhancing energy effectiveness.

Lubricate Tracks: For sliding and bi-fold doors, make sure the tracks are clean and lubricated to assist in smooth opening and closing.

Inspect Hardware: Periodically inspect the deals with, locks, and hinges to guarantee all elements are working correctly.

Schedule Professional Inspections: Engage professionals yearly for an extensive evaluation, ensuring that potential issues are determined early.
Regularly Asked QuestionsQ1: Are glass window doors energy-efficient?
A1: Yes, many modern-day glass window doors have energy-efficient features, consisting of low-E glass coatings, which decrease heat transfer and assistance keep a comfortable indoor temperature level.
Q2: Are glass doors safe for kids and family pets?
A2: Glass doors created for security include tempered glass, which is less likely to shatter. However, guidance and precaution are advised, especially for children and pets.
Q3: How much do glass window doors cost?
A3: The cost can differ substantially based on size, type, frame product, and installation. It is suggested to get several quotes and think about long-lasting energy savings when budgeting.
Q4: Do glass window doors require special maintenance?
A4: While maintenance is very little, routine cleaning and checking seals and hardware can help ensure durability. Follow maker guidelines for maintenance specifics.
Q5: Can glass doors be installed in any type of home?
A5: Yes, glass window doors can be adjusted for practically any home type. However, considerations such as structural integrity and regional building regulations ought to be considered.
